Output 8666b621fd0c7507b9cd5229d69f84881b04c41af5aee7114dee8048c98df5b1:1

value
1000153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f27cee9e630bcb1cbdcb0e6b126fb870ac63293 OP_EQUALVERIFY OP_CHECKSIG
address
1JRjkZpE9XYySP3wsF1j4kSo4jauDm9S9A
transaction
8666b621fd0c7507b9cd5229d69f84881b04c41af5aee7114dee8048c98df5b1
spent
true